What is Gamification in the Workplace?
Gamification is when companies add game-like elements to regular work tasks. This can include:
- Points for completing tasks
- Badges for achievements
- Leaderboards to show rankings
- Fun challenges to solve problems
The main idea is to make work more interesting. Instead of just doing tasks for money or promotions, employees feel motivated to do their best because it’s enjoyable.
Xendit uses gamification to track performance, help employees learn new skills, and encourage teamwork. This way, employees stay motivated while learning and improving their work.
Key Strategies from Xendit Gamification Summit
Here are the main strategies shared at the summit that can help make work more fun and productive.
1. Goal-Oriented Challenges
At Xendit, employees take part in challenges with clear goals. Each goal has a set deadline, and progress is tracked.
For example, a sales team may compete to reach monthly targets. Every milestone earns points. This makes employees work harder while still feeling like they are part of a team.
2. Rewards and Recognition
Everyone likes to be recognized for their efforts. Xendit gives rewards for achievements, such as:
- Digital badges
- Certificates
- Small gifts or perks
Rewards make employees feel appreciated. They also encourage them to continue performing well and following company goals.
3. Interactive Learning and Skill Development
Gamification can also make learning fun. At Xendit, employees join quizzes, workshops, and games to learn new skills.
This method helps employees remember things better and enjoy learning. It’s a great way to improve skills while staying motivated.
4. Real-Time Feedback and Tracking
Feedback is important for improvement. Xendit uses dashboards that show progress in real-time.
Employees can see how they are performing compared to others. Managers can also check who is doing well and who needs help. This keeps everyone motivated and focused on improvement.
5. Team-Based Competitions
Teamwork is important in any company. Xendit uses team challenges to make employees work together.
Teams combine their points and efforts to reach goals. This encourages communication, collaboration, and support among employees. It also makes work more fun and less stressful.
6. Personalized Gamification
Not everyone is motivated by the same things. Xendit lets employees choose challenges and rewards that match their interests.
This helps employees feel in control and keeps them engaged. Personalized gamification makes work feel more meaningful and enjoyable.

Challenges to Keep in Mind
Even though gamification is helpful, it must be used carefully:
- Don’t make it too competitive—it can stress employees
- Make rewards fair and clear
- Personalize challenges to match employees’ interests
- Keep challenges fresh and interesting
By avoiding these mistakes, companies can make gamification work really well.
